Connect(LocalSocketAddress, Int32) 將此套接字連線至端點。 Connect(LocalSocketAddress) 將此套接字連線至端點。 C# 複製 [Android.Runtime.Register("connect", "(Landroid/net/LocalSocketAddress;)V", "GetConnect_Landroid_net_LocalSocketAddress_Handler")] public virtual void Connect (Android.Net....
// LocalSocketService.ADDRESS 这个是连接的地址,相当于每个连接标示符,你想连接到这个上 localSocket.connect(new LocalSocketAddress(LocalSocketService.ADDRESS)); Log.i("MainActivity", "localSocket.isConnected() = " +localSocket.isConnected()); // 设置接收的缓存空间的大小 localSocket.setReceiveBuffer...
1.3 clientSocket 代码语言:javascript 复制 #import<GCDAsyncSocket.h>@interfaceViewController(){GCDAsyncSocket*_clientSocket;}@end @implementation ViewController-(void)viewDidLoad{[superviewDidLoad];// Do any additional setup after loading the view.[self connectToServer];}-(void)connectToServer{//1...
值得一提的是,我最初使用原生socket函数,没想connect总是返回错误;后来在同事的提醒下,我参考了Android源码rild.c中socket_local_client的使用,并从socket_local_client.c中抽取出相应代码改写而成。 客户端native方法头文件: 1/*DO NOT EDIT THIS FILE - it is machine generated*/2#include <jni.h>3/*Head...
I 、方案案例:local socket 1.1 基础知识:Socket 通讯过程 1.2 serverSocket 1.3 clientSocket 1.4 完整demo see also 前言 如果你对IPC不了解,可以先看下这篇- Inter process Communication 登录iTunes Store 这个输入框的弹出流程是由itunesstored 控制,process:SpringBoard 进行处理,采用SBUserNotificationAlert的方式...
值得一提的是,我最初使用原生socket函数,没想connect总是返回错误;后来在同事的提醒下,我参考了Android源码rild.c中socket_local_client的使用,并从socket_local_client.c中抽取出相应代码改写而成。 客户端native方法头文件: 1/*DO NOT EDIT THIS FILE - it is machine generated*/2#include <jni.h>3/*...
if( connect(clientSocket, (struct sockaddr *)&serverAddr, sizeof(serverAddr)) < 0) { // connect 失败 return - 1; } ... 首先我们通过socket系统调用创建了一个socket,其中指定了SOCK_STREAM,而且最后一个参数为0,也就是建立了一个通常所有的TCP Socket。在这里,我们直接给出TCP Socket所对应的ops...
if(connect(clientSocket, (struct sockaddr *)&serverAddr, sizeof(serverAddr)) < 0) { // connect 失败 return -1; } ... 首先我们通过socket系统调用创建了一个socket,其中指定了SOCK_STREAM,而且最后一个参数为0,也就是建立了一个通常所有的TCP Socket。在这里,我们直接给出TCP Socket所对应的ops也就...
privatevoiddemoClient()throwsIOException{LocalSocketclient=newLocalSocket();client.connect(newLocalSocketAddress("me.linjw.localsocket"));client.getOutputStream().write(123);intread=client.getInputStream().read();Log.d(TAG,"response from server : "+read);client.close();}privatevoiddemoServer()...
connect函数的第一个参数即为客户端的socket描述字,第二参数为服务器的socket地址,第三个参数为socket地址的长度。客户端通过调用connect函数来建立与TCP服务器的连接。 3.4、accept()函数 TCP服务器端依次调用socket()、bind()、listen()之后,就会监听指定的socket地址了。TCP客户端依次调用socket()、connect()之后就...